Idris Elba Opens Up About The Wire Experience
Idris Elba, known for his iconic role as Stringer Bell on HBO's The Wire, revealed on Amy Poehler's Good Hang podcast that he has never watched the series, despite it being pivotal for his career. Elba finds it emotionally difficult to revisit the show, especially due to the impact of Stringer Bell's death, and feels somewhat 'outside of the club' of fans who celebrate its legacy. He also expressed discomfort with watching his own performances, preferring to focus on acting rather than self-critique. Elba acknowledged The Wire's ongoing importance and its multi-generational influence. The show's creator, David Simon, intended Stringer Bell's fate to underscore the harsh realities of the drug trade, solidifying both the character's and Elba's impact on television history. Despite not having watched the series himself, Elba remains proud of his contribution.
